Domain I (DI) of beta-2-glycoprotein I (ß2GPI) contains the immunodominant epitope for pathogenic antiphospholipid antibodies (aPL). DI is exposed in the linear form of the molecule but not in the circular form that comprises 90% of serum ß2GPI. The majority of circulating ß2GPI is biochemically reduced with two free thiols in Domain V. However, increased levels of oxidised ß2GPI are found in patients with antiphospholipid syndrome (APS). It is not known whether oxidation of ß2GPI favours the linear form of the molecule and thus promotes development of anti-DI antibodies. We investigated whether the proportion of oxidised ß2GPI associates with the presence of anti-DI in APS patients. Serum samples from 44 APS patients were screened for IgG, IgM and IgA anti-DI, anti-ß2GPI, anti-cardiolipin (anti-CL) and biochemically reduced ß2GPI. A negative correlation was found between the proportion of ß2GPI in the biochemically reduced form and IgG anti-DI levels (r = -0.54, p = 0.0002), but not with IgM or IgA anti-DI. Moreover, the proportion of ß2GPI in the reduced form was lower in IgG anti-DI positive than anti-DI negative APS patients (p = 0.02). The relative amount of reduced ß2GPI was no different between patients who were positive or negative for IgG, IgM and IgA anti-ß2GPI or anti-CL. This study demonstrates that oxidised ß2GPI lacking free cysteine-thiol groups most closely associates with IgG anti-DI positivity compared to IgG anti-CL and anti-ß2GPI. Future studies are required to ascertain the directionality of this association to define causation.

OBJECTIVE: Both environmental and genetic factors are important in the development of antiphospholipid antibodies (aPL) in patients with antiphospholipid syndrome (APS). Currently, the only available data on predisposing genetic factors have been obtained from epidemiologic studies, without mechanistic evidence. Therefore, we studied the influence of major histocompatibility complex (MHC) class II alleles on the production of aPL in a mouse model of APS. METHODS: Three groups of mice, MHC class II-deficient (MHCII-/- ) mice, MHCII-/- mice transgenic for human HLA-DQ6 (DQ6), DQ8, or DR4 alleles, and the corresponding wild-type (WT) mouse strains were immunized; half were immunized with human ß2 -glycoprotein I (ß2 GPI), and the other half were immunized with control ovalbumin (OVA) protein. Thrombus formation in vivo, tissue factor activity in carotid and peritoneal macrophages, and serum levels of tumor necrosis factor (TNF), IgG anticardiolipin (aCL), antibodies, and anti-OVA antibodies were determined. RESULTS: Immunization with ß2 GPI induced significant production of aCL and anti-ß2 GPI in WT mice compared with control mice immunized with OVA (P < 0.001) but diminished aCL (P < 0.001) and anti-ß2 GPI (P = 0.016) production in MHCII-/- mice. Anti-ß2 GPI production was fully restored in DQ6 and DQ8 mice, while levels of anti-ß2 GPI in DR4 mice and aCL in all transgenic lines were only partially restored (P < 0.001 to P < 0.046). Thrombus size in WT mice was twice that in MHCII-/- mice (P < 0.001) but similar to that in all transgenic lines. Carotid and peritoneal macrophage tissue factor levels decreased by >50% in MHCII-/- mice compared with wild-type B6 mice and were restored in DQ8 mice but not DR4 mice or DQ6 mice. TNF levels decreased 4-fold in MHCII-/- mice (P < 0.001) and were not restored in transgenic mice. CONCLUSION: Our mechanistic study is the first to show that MHC class II alleles influence not only quantitative aPL production but also the pathogenic capacity of induced aPL.

Tolerogenic dendritic cells (tDCs) have the potential to control the outcome of autoimmunity by modulating the immune response. The aim of this study was to uncover the tolerance efficacy attributed to beta-2-glycoprotein-I (ß2GPI) tDCs or ß2GPI domain-I (D-I) and domain-V (D-V)-tDCs in mice with antiphospholipid syndrome (APS). tDCs were pulsed with ß2GPI or D-I or D-V derivatives. Our results revealed that ß2GPI related tDCs phenotype includes CD80(high), CD86(high) CD40(high) MHC class II(high). The miRNA profiling encompass miRNA 23b(high), miRNA 142-3p(low) and miRNA 221(low). In addition the ß2GPI related tDCs showed reduced secretion of IL-1ß, IL-12 and IL-23. D-I tDCs treatment was more efficient than ß2GPI tDCs in inducing of tolerance in APS mice, manifested by lowered titers of anti- ß2GPI antibodies (Abs) and reduced percentage of fetal loss. Tolerance induction was accompanied by poor T cell response to ß2GPI, high numbers of CD4 + CD25 + FOXP3 + T-regulatory cells (Treg), reduced levels of IFNγ, IL-17 and increased expression of IL-10 and TGFß. Tolerance was successfully transferred by Treg cells from the tolerized mice to ß2GPI immunized mice. We conclude that predominantly D-I-tDCs and ß2GPI tDCs have the potential to attenuate experimental APS by induction of Treg cells, reduction of anti- ß2GPI Abs titers and increased expression of anti-inflammatory cytokines. We suggest that ß2-GPI-D-I-tDCs may offer a novel approach for developing therapy for APS patients.

OBJECTIVE: To determine if proinflammatory and prothrombotic biomarkers are differentially upregulated in persistently antiphospholipid antibody (aPL)-positive patients, and to examine the effects of fluvastatin on these biomarkers. METHODS: Four groups of patients (age 18-65) were recruited: (a) primary antiphospholipid syndrome; (b) systemic lupus erythematosus (SLE) with antiphospholipid syndrome (APS) (SLE/APS); (c) persistent aPL positivity without SLE or APS (Primary aPL); and (d) persistent aPL positivity with SLE but no APS (SLE/aPL). The frequency-matched control group, used for baseline data comparison, was identified from a databank of healthy persons. Patients received fluvastatin 40 mg daily for 3 months. At 3 months, patients stopped the study medication and they were followed for another 3 months. Blood samples for 12 proinflammatory and prothrombotic biomarkers were collected monthly for 6 months. RESULTS: Based on the comparison of the baseline samples of 41 aPL-positive patients with 30 healthy controls, 9/12 (75%) biomarkers (interleukin (IL)-6, IL1ß, vascular endothelial growth factor (VEGF), tumour necrosis factor (TNF)-α, interferon (IFN)-α, inducible protein-10 (IP10), soluble CD40 ligand (sCD40L), soluble tissue factor (sTF) and intracellular cellular adhesion molecule (ICAM)-1) were significantly elevated. Twenty-four patients completed the study; fluvastatin significantly and reversibly reduced the levels of 6/12 (50%) biomarkers (IL1ß, VEGF, TNFα, IP10, sCD40L and sTF). CONCLUSIONS: Our prospective mechanistic study demonstrates that proinflammatory and prothrombotic biomarkers, which are differentially upregulated in persistently aPL-positive patients, can be reversibly reduced by fluvastatin. Thus, statin-induced modulation of the aPL effects on target cells can be a valuable future approach in the management of aPL-positive patients.

PROBLEM: Aim of our study was to investigate whether TIFI, a syntetic peptide able to compete with anti-phospholipid antibodies (aPL) in the binding to endothelium, may restore aPL-inhibited endometrial angiogenesis. METHODS: The protective role of TIFI was evaluated on: i) aPL-inhibited of human endometrial endothelial cells (HEEC) angiogenesis in vitro; ii) aPL-inhibited vascular endothelial growth factor (VEGF) and metalloproteases (MMPs) expression; iii) aPL-inhibited Nuclear Factor-κB (NF-κB) and Extracellular signal-Regulated Kinase (ERK) activation and (iv) angiogenesis in vivo. RESULTS: TIFI restores in a dose-dependent manner: i) aPL-mediated inhibition of HEEC angiogenesis in vitro and in vivo (P < 0.05), ii) VEGF (P < 0.001) and MMP-2 (P < 0.05) expression and iii) NF-κB DNA binding and ERK-1/2 activation (P < 0.05) inhibited by aPL. CONCLUSION: Our results show for the first time the protective effects of TIFI, as represented by its ability to interfere with aPL mediated anti-angiogenic activity.

ß2 glycoprotein I (ß2GPI)-dependent anti-phospholipid antibodies (aPL) induce thrombosis and affect pregnancy. The CMV-derived synthetic peptide TIFI mimics the PL-binding site of ß2GPI and inhibits ß2GPI cell-binding in vitro and aPL-mediated thrombosis in vivo. Here we investigated the effect of TIFI on aPL-induced fetal loss in mice. TIFI inhibitory effect on in vitro aPL binding to human trophoblasts was evaluated by indirect immunofluorescence and ELISA. TIFI effect on aPL-induced fetal loss was investigated in pregnant C57BL/6 mice treated with aPL or normal IgG (NHS). Placenta/fetus weight and histology and RNA expression were analyzed. TIFI, but not the control peptide VITT, displayed a dose-dependent inhibition of aPL binding to trophoblasts in vitro. Injection of low doses of aPL at day 0 of pregnancy caused growth retardation and increased fetal loss rate, both significantly reduced by TIFI but not VITT. Consistent with observations in humans, histological analysis showed no evidence of inflammation in this model, as confirmed by the absence of an inflammatory signature in gene expression analysis, which in turn revealed a TIFI-dependent modulation of molecules involved in differentiation and development processes. These findings support the non-inflammatory pathogenic role of aPL and suggest innovative therapeutic approaches to aPL-dependent fetal loss.

Fluvastatin has been shown to revert proinflammatory/prothrombotic effects of antiphospholipid antibodies (aPL) in vitro and in mice. Here, we examined whether fluvastatin affects the levels of proinflammatory/prothrombotic markers in antiphospholipid syndrome (APS) patients. Vascular endothelial growth factor (VEGF), soluble tissue factor (sTF), tumor necrosis factor-alpha (TNF-alpha), soluble intercellular adhesion molecule-1 (sICAM-1), sE-selectin (E-sel), C-reactive protein (CRP), and soluble vascular cell adhesion molecule (sVCAM-1), were measured in the sera of 93 APS patients and 60 controls and in the sera of nine patients with APS before and after 30 days of treatment with fluvastatin. Elevated levels of VEGF, sTF, and TNF-alpha were found in APS patients. Fluvastatin significantly reduced those markers in the majority of treated subjects. The data from this study show that statins may be beneficial in aPL-positive patients and warrant larger clinical trials to confirm the efficacy of the drug for the treatment of APS clinical manifestations.

Los anticuerpos antifosfolípidos están asociados con trombosis y pérdidas fetales en pacientes con síndrome antifosfolípido. Se han descrito diversos mecanismos patogénicos para explicar las manifestaciones clínicas producidas por los anticuerpos. En esta revisión se discuten las modalidades corrientes para el tratamiento y se describe en detalle una actualización de las pruebas de laboratorio utilizadas para confirmar el diagnóstico de síndrome antifosfolípido. La prueba de anticuerpos anticardiolipina ha sido utilizada ampliamente por los médicos desde la mitad de los años 80 para el diagnóstico de pacientes con síndrome antifosfolípido. Establecer correctamente un diagnóstico permite manejar efectivamente pacientes con trombosis recurrentes y pérdidas fetales. La prueba de anticuerpos anticardiolipina fue establecida en 1983 como una técnica de radioinmunoensayo y fue luego convertida en un enzimoinmunoensayo (ELISA). Otra prueba utilizada comunmente en el diagnóstico de síndrome antifosfolípido es el anticoagulante lúpico. La prueba de anticuerpos anticardiolipina por ELISA essensible para el diagnóstico de síndrome antifosfolípido pero de baja especificidad. Por otra parte, la prueba de anticoagulante lúpico, no obstante ser más específica, no es tan sensible como la prueba de anticuerpos anticardiolipina por ELISA. Se han desarrollado otras pruebas más específicas como la determinación de anticuerpos anti-ß2 glicoproteína I (anti-ß2GPI), antiprotrombina (anti-PT) y la prueba APhL por ELISA, que utiliza fosfolípidos cargados negativamente en lugar de cardiolipina como antígeno para cubrir los platos de microtitulación. Este módulo trata en detalle el valor clínico de las pruebas antes mencionadas, los problemas técnicos asociados con ellas, los criterios utilizados por el laboratorio para el diagnóstico de síndrome antifosfolípido y las posibles nuevas y mejores pruebas que estarán disponibles en un futuro cercano para el diagnóstico de síndrome antifosfolípido.

OBJECTIVE: Venous thrombotic events (VTE), including both deep venous thrombosis and pulmonary emboli, are now recognized as an important complication of Wegener's granulomatosis (WG), but the mechanism(s) of this occurrence is unclear. The frequency of anticardiolipin antibodies (aCL), anti-beta2-glycoprotein antibodies (anti-beta2-GP), and several genetic hypercoagulable factors were examined in a large cohort of patients with WG. METHODS: One hundred eighty patients with active WG had serum and DNA samples collected upon entry into a clinical trial. Of the 180 patients, 29 patients had VTE -- 13 before trial entry, 16 during trial. aCL (IgG, IgM, and IgA) and anti-beta2-GP (IgG and IgM) were evaluated in 176 patients. Factor V Leiden (FVL), the prothrombin gene mutation (G20210A, PGM), and methylenetetrahydrofolate reductase (MTHFR) gene mutation were tested in the 29 patients with thrombotic events, and 36 patients without. RESULTS: aCL occurred with increased frequencies in patients with WG when compared to the general population (1%-5%): 12% had aCL and 3% had anti-beta2-GP. There was no difference in the prevalences of aCL or anti-beta2-GP based on clotting status. The prevalence of the genetic hypercoagulable factors examined in patients with WG was comparable to the reported rates in the general population. CONCLUSION: Although the incidence of clinically significant VTE is increased in patients with WG, this increased risk is not explained by increased prevalences of aCL, anti-beta2-GP, FVL, or mutations in PGM or MTHFR. These observations suggest a need to search for new genetic or acquired prothrombotic abnormalities to account for the increased thrombotic event rate in patients with active WG.

OBJECTIVE: Previous studies in small cohorts of patients with Wegener's granulomatosis (WG) or antineutrophil cytoplasmic antibody (ANCA) associated vasculitis have yielded conflicting data regarding the prevalence of antiendothelial cell antibodies (AECA), ranging from 8% to 100%, and the use of AECA as a measure of disease activity. We examined a large, well-characterized cohort of patients with WG and active disease for the presence of AECA. METHODS: Serum from subjects with WG who participated in a clinical therapeutic trial was collected at baseline, when all subjects had active disease. Clinical manifestations and disease activity were documented using the Birmingham Vasculitis Activity Score for WG (BVAS/WG). Serum AECA (IgG) was measured by cyto-ELISA using unfixed human umbilical vein endothelial cells (HUVEC). The AECA positivity cutoff was determined using 71 healthy control samples. Statistical analyses utilized Student's t test, chi-square and Fisher's exact tests, and linear regression. RESULTS: AECA were detected in 34 of 173 (20%) evaluated serum samples. Mean BVAS/WG did not differ between patients with (7.3 +/- 3.2) or without AECA (7.0 +/- 3.3) (p = 0.58). Among the 34 patients positive for AECA, the antibody titer did not correlate with disease activity (BVAS/WG; r = 0.09, p = 0.60). There were no statistically significant differences in the frequency of major clinical manifestations between patients with or without AECA. CONCLUSION: AECA, as measured using HUVEC, are not highly prevalent among patients with active WG, are not associated with specific clinical manifestations, and do not correlate with level of disease activity.

OBJECTIVE: To evaluate the effectiveness for the outcomes of endometriosis-related pain and quality of life of conservative surgery plus placebo compared with conservative surgery plus hormonal suppression treatment or dietary therapy. DESIGN: Randomized comparative trial. SETTING: University hospital. PATIENT(S): Two hundred twenty-two consecutive women who underwent conservative pelvic surgery for symptomatic endometriosis stage III-IV (r-AFS). INTERVENTION(S): Six months of placebo (n = 110) versus GnRH-a (tryptorelin or leuprorelin, 3.75 mg every 28 days) (n = 39) or continuous estroprogestin (ethynilestradiol, 0.03 mg plus gestoden, 0.75 mg) (n = 38) versus dietary therapy (vitamins, minerals salts, lactic ferments, fish oil) (n = 35). MAIN OUTCOME MEASURE(S): Painful symptoms (visual analogue scale score) and quality-of-life endometriosis-related symptoms (SF-36 score) at 12 months' follow-up. RESULT(S): Patients treated with postoperative hormonal suppression therapy showed less visual analogue scale scores for dysmenorrhoea than patients of the other groups. Hormonal suppression therapy and dietary supplementation were equally effective in reducing nonmenstrual pelvic pain. Surgery plus placebo showed significative decrease in dyspareunia scores. Postoperative medical and dietary therapy allowed a better quality of life than placebo. CONCLUSION(S): Postoperative hormonal suppression treatment or dietary therapy are more effective than surgery plus placebo to obtain relief of pain associated with endometriosis stage III-IV and improvement of quality of life.

OBJETIVO: O ensaio de enzyme-linked immunosorbent assay (ELISA) para a pesquisa de anticorpos anticardiolipina (aCL) é o mais importante teste para o diagnóstico da síndrome antifosfolipídica (SAF). Entretanto esse teste também pode ser positivo em algumas doenças infecciosas. Tem sido sugerido que a detecção de anticorpos para uma mistura de fosfolípides ou para b2-glicoproteína I (b2-GP I) teria uma maior especificidade para a SAF que o teste de ELISA-padrão para aCL. O objetivo do presente estudo é comparar a especificidade de três testes para anticorpos antifosfolípides (aFL) em pacientes com doenças infecciosas. MÉTODOS: Anticorpos antifosfolípides foram pesquisados por três técnicas de ELISA, ou seja, o teste-padrão para aCL, o kit de ELISA APhL® e o teste para anti-b2-GP I em pacientes com doenças infecciosas, tais como sífilis (69), leptospirose (33) e Calazar (30). RESULTADOS: A freqüência de positividade de aFL da classe IgG em pacientes com sífilis, leptospirose e Calazar foi de 13/69 (19 por cento), 9/33 (27 por cento) e 2/30 (6 por cento), respectivamente, com o ELISA-padrão para aCL versus 1/69 (1,4 por cento), 0/33 (0 por cento) e 0/30 (0 por cento) com o kit de ELISA APhL®. A positividade do isotipo IgM foi de 10/69 (14 por cento), 4/33 (12 por cento) e 1/30 (3 por cento), respectivamente, com o ELISA-padrão para aCL, e 1/69 (1,4 por cento), 0/33 (0 por cento) e 0/30 (0 por cento) com o kit de ELISA APhL®. Anticorpos da classe IgG contra b2GPI foram detectados em 14/69 casos de sífilis (20 por cento), 6/33 casos de leptospirose (18 por cento) e 16/30 casos de Calazar (53 por cento). Assim, o kit de ELISA APhL® apresentou uma maior especificidade: 97 por cento (95 por cento CI: 92 por cento-99 por cento) comparado com 81 por cento (95 por cento CI: 74 por cento-87 por cento) para o teste de aCL-padrão e 72 por cento (95 por cento CI: 64 por cento-79 por cento) para o teste de anticorpos anti-b2 GPI. Our observations and those from others, give further support to our hypothesis that "autoimmune aPL" may be generated by immunization with products from bacteria or viruses after incidental exposure or infection. We also were able to generate APS-like syndrome in a strain of mice susceptible to autoimmunity, indicating that other factors such as genetics are likely to be involved in the development of APS. Furthermore, not all aPL antibodies generated by immunization with bacterial or viral products are pathogenic. Based on the clinical experience and on the numerous reports indicating presence of aPL in a large number of infectious diseases, it may be expected that not all aPL antibodies produced during infection will be pathogenic. We hypothesize that a limited number aPL antibodies induced by certain viral/bacterial products would be pathogenic in certain groups of predisposed individuals. Identification of these bacterial and/ or viral agents may help to find strategies for the prevention of production of aPL "pathogenic" antibodies. Alternatively, free peptides may be used to induce tolerance against aPL production.

The antiphosphospholipid antibody syndrome (APS) describes a clinical entity with recurrent thrombosis, fetal loss, thrombocytopenia in the presence of lupus anticoagulant and/or antibodies to cardiolipin. These antibodies may be associated with connective tissue diseases such as systemic lupus erythematosus (secondary APS) or be found in isolation (primary APS). Renal syndromes increasingly being reported in association with these antibodies include thrombotic microangiopathy, renal vein thrombosis, renal infarction, renal artery stenosis and/or malignant hypertension, increased allograft vascular thrombosis, and reduced survival of renal allografts. Although much has been understood concerning the biology of these antibodies and the pathogenesis of thrombosis, the optimal therapy remains to be elucidated. This article presents a historical review of the renal involvement in the antiphospholipid syndrome and discusses therapeutic options. Further research is needed.

To assess the helper T cell dependence of B lymphocyte stimulator (BLyS) protein-driven autoantibody production in vivo, serum levels of BLyS protein, total IgG, and anti-IgG anti-phospholipid (aPhL) autoantibodies from HIV-infected patients (n = 105) with varying degrees of CD4+ cell depletion and healthy control donors at low risk for HIV (n = 64) were determined. Peripheral blood mononuclear cells from these subjects were stained for surface expression of BLyS protein. Monocyte surface expression and serum levels of BLyS protein were increased in HIV-infected patients as were serum total IgG and IgG aPhL autoantibody levels. No associations were detected between increased serum BLyS protein levels and patient age, sex, disease duration, history of opportunistic infection or malignancy, or serum total IgG levels. However, serum levels of IgG aPhL autoantibodies were greater in patients with high serum BLyS protein levels than in those with normal serum BLyS protein levels. Antiphospholipid antibodies (aPL) have been associated with different diseases. They are defined as a large family of immunoglobulins (Ig) of either alloantibodies or autoantibodies. The autoimmune antibodies are associated with venous and/or arterial thrombosis, thrombocytopenia and recurrent fetal loss in the so-called antiphospholipid syndrome or in systemic lupus erythematosus. These antibodies are directed against proteins or phospholipid-protein complexes. On the contrary, antiphospholipid antibodies (alloantibodies) which are found in infectious diseases sera (syphilis, HIV, and other viral diseases), disappear with illness remission and are directed to phospholipids alone (particularly cardiolipin) and are not associated with thrombosis or recurrent fetal loss. However, the role and type of aPL found during hepatic diseases is still unclear. To investigate the prevalence of autoimmune aPL (IgG and IgM) during different hepatic diseases, we have studied 128 patients with hepatitis C virus, hepatitis B virus and hepatic autoimmune diseases without treatment as well as 40 healthy control subjects. We have used a specific ELISA kit, that uses a mixture of phospholipid instead of cardiolipin alone, and allows a better detection of aPL of the autoimmune type. Our results show that autoimmune aPL are not significantly increased in viral hepatic diseases (2%) or autoimmune diseases of the liver (3%) when compared to the control group (0%).
